网络上网流量如何实现网络资源优化?
在互联网高速发展的今天,网络已经成为我们生活中不可或缺的一部分。然而,随着网络流量的不断增加,如何实现网络资源优化成为了我们关注的焦点。本文将围绕“网络上网流量如何实现网络资源优化”这一主题,从多个角度进行探讨。
一、了解网络资源优化的概念
首先,我们需要明确什么是网络资源优化。网络资源优化是指通过技术手段,提高网络资源的利用率,降低网络拥堵,提升用户体验的过程。在这个过程中,主要包括以下几个方面:
- 流量分配:合理分配网络带宽,确保重要应用和用户得到充足的带宽资源。
- 缓存策略:通过缓存技术,减少对网络资源的重复请求,提高访问速度。
- 负载均衡:通过将请求分发到多个服务器,减轻单个服务器的压力,提高整体性能。
- 网络加速:通过优化网络传输路径,减少数据传输延迟,提高访问速度。
二、网络流量优化策略
- 流量分配
(1)优先级分配:根据应用的重要性和用户需求,对流量进行优先级分配。例如,将视频会议、在线教育等实时应用设置为高优先级,确保其流畅运行。
(2)动态调整:根据网络流量变化,动态调整带宽分配策略,避免网络拥堵。
- 缓存策略
(1)本地缓存:在用户设备上缓存常用数据,减少对网络资源的请求。
(2)CDN缓存:在互联网边缘节点部署缓存服务器,将热点内容缓存到离用户较近的位置,提高访问速度。
- 负载均衡
(1)DNS轮询:将请求分发到多个服务器,实现负载均衡。
(2)IP哈希:根据用户IP地址,将请求分发到不同的服务器,确保请求均匀分配。
- 网络加速
(1)压缩传输:对数据进行压缩,减少数据传输量,提高访问速度。
(2)DNS预解析:在用户访问网页时,预先解析域名,减少DNS查询时间。
三、案例分析
- 视频网站优化
以某视频网站为例,通过以下措施实现网络资源优化:
(1)流量分配:将高清视频设置为高优先级,确保流畅播放。
(2)缓存策略:在CDN节点部署缓存服务器,缓存热点视频。
(3)负载均衡:采用DNS轮询和IP哈希,实现负载均衡。
- 电商平台优化
以某电商平台为例,通过以下措施实现网络资源优化:
(1)流量分配:将商品详情页设置为高优先级,确保用户快速获取信息。
(2)缓存策略:在CDN节点部署缓存服务器,缓存商品图片和描述。
(3)网络加速:对商品数据进行压缩,减少数据传输量。
四、总结
网络资源优化是提高网络性能、降低成本、提升用户体验的重要手段。通过流量分配、缓存策略、负载均衡和网络加速等技术手段,我们可以实现网络资源的优化。在实际应用中,需要根据具体场景和需求,选择合适的优化策略,以达到最佳效果。
猜你喜欢:应用故障定位